bunch a group of things of the same kind that are attached to each other.
curious eager to learn or know.
goal a result or end that a person wants and works for; aim or purpose.
impossible not able to happen or to be done.
kiss to touch or press with the lips as a sign of love or respect.
mask a covering that hides all or part of the face.
murder the crime of killing a person.
mustache the hair that grows above the upper lip.
peck2 to strike, or pick up quickly with the beak.
person a human being.
robbery the act of stealing money or property from a person or place; the act of robbing.
sack a large bag made of thick paper or other strong material. A sack is used to hold grain, potatoes, supplies, or other heavy things.
spine the set of bones that go down the center of the back of a human or animal.
stir to mix liquids together or move a liquid in a circle using your hand or an object.
vacation a period of rest from school, work, or other activities.
